Overview

Circular liquid surface covering balls are small, floating spheres designed to cover the surface of liquids in storage tanks or containers. They are widely used in industries such as chemical processing, wastewater treatment, and pharmaceuticals to minimize evaporation, reduce oxidation, and prevent contamination. These balls are typically made from materials like polyethylene or stainless steel, ensuring durability and resistance to various chemicals. The design of these balls allows them to float and form a continuous layer on the liquid surface, effectively creating a barrier between the liquid and the surrounding air. This simple yet effective solution helps maintain the quality and integrity of stored liquids, making it a cost-effective option for industrial applications.

Structure and Working Principle

Circular liquid surface covering balls are hollow or semi-hollow spheres, often with a smooth surface to ensure easy movement and coverage. Their buoyancy allows them to float on the liquid surface, where they spread out to form a dense layer. This layer reduces the exposed surface area of the liquid, thereby minimizing evaporation and contact with airborne contaminants. The working principle is based on the physical barrier created by the balls, which limits the exchange of gases between the liquid and the atmosphere. This is particularly important for volatile or sensitive liquids that can degrade or evaporate quickly when exposed to air. The balls' design ensures they remain on the surface without sinking, even in dynamic or agitated liquid conditions.

Key Features

One of the standout features of circular liquid surface covering balls is their chemical resistance. Materials like polyethylene and stainless steel are chosen for their ability to withstand harsh environments, including exposure to acids, alkalis, and organic solvents. This makes them suitable for a wide range of industrial applications. Another key feature is their lightweight nature, which ensures they remain buoyant and easy to handle. The balls are also designed to be durable, with resistance to UV radiation and temperature fluctuations, depending on the material. Their simple design allows for easy deployment and retrieval, making them a practical solution for liquid surface management.

Application Areas

Circular liquid surface covering balls are used in various industries, including chemical manufacturing, where they protect stored chemicals from evaporation and contamination. In wastewater treatment plants, they help reduce odor and volatile organic compound (VOC) emissions by limiting the exposure of wastewater to air. The pharmaceutical industry also utilizes these balls to maintain the purity of sensitive liquids. Additionally, they are employed in fuel storage tanks to minimize evaporation losses and prevent the formation of explosive vapors. Their versatility and effectiveness make them a valuable tool in any setting where liquid surface protection is required.

Maintenance and Precautions

Maintenance of circular liquid surface covering balls is minimal, primarily involving periodic inspection for damage or wear. Balls made from polyethylene may become brittle over time if exposed to UV radiation, so storing them in a shaded area or using UV-resistant materials can extend their lifespan. Precautions include ensuring the balls are compatible with the stored liquid to avoid chemical reactions or degradation. For high-temperature applications, selecting balls made from heat-resistant materials is crucial. Proper handling and storage when not in use will also help maintain their effectiveness and longevity.

B2B Procurement Guide

When procuring circular liquid surface covering balls, consider the material's compatibility with the liquids they will contact. Polyethylene balls are cost-effective and suitable for many applications, while stainless steel balls offer superior durability for harsh environments. The size and quantity of balls needed depend on the surface area to be covered. Supplier reliability and product certifications are also important factors. Look for suppliers with a proven track record in industrial applications and ensure the balls meet relevant industry standards. Bulk purchasing can often lead to cost savings, but always verify the quality and specifications before committing to large orders.
